| Abstract: | Di-jet production is studied in collisions of quasi-real photons radiated by the LEP beams at e+e- centre-of-mass energies from 189 to 209 GeV. The data have been taken with the OPAL detector. Jets are reconstructed using a k⊥-clustering algorithm. The inclusive di-jet cross-section is measured as a function of the mean transverse energy of the two jets, and as a function of xγ for different regions of . Furthermore the inclusive di-jet cross-section as a function of │ηjet│ and │Δηjet│ is presented, where ηjet is the jet pseudo-rapidity. Different regions of the -space are explored to study and control the influence of a possible underlying event. The results are compared to next-to-leading order perturbative QCD calculations and to the predictions of the leading order Monte Carlo generator PYTHIA. |
